Bhavashankara (भवशंकर) is a Sanskrit-origin boy's name meaning "Shiva who blesses existence." It is associated with Mula nakshatra and Dhanu rashi. The Chaldean numerology value is 8 (Power).

Meaning & Etymology

Meaning

Shiva who blesses existence · the auspicious lord of being

Etymology

From "bhava" (one of the eight names of Shiva, meaning existence) and "shankara" (the auspicious, beneficent — another name of Shiva). The "Bha" syllable marks Mula nakshatra. A deeply devotional name invoking Shiva's dual role as creator and destroyer.

Why This Name Fits Mula Nakshatra

In Vedic astrology, the nakshatra (lunar mansion) at the time of birth determines which syllables are auspicious for the child's name. Mulanakshatra prescribes names starting with "Ye", "Yo", "Bha", "Bhi".Bhavashankara begins with "Bha", making it a traditionally appropriate choice for children born under Mula.

The belief is that using the correct starting syllable aligns the child's name with the vibrational energy of their birth nakshatra, creating harmony between the individual and the cosmos. This practice is recorded in the Brihat Parashara Hora Shastra and is still widely followed across India.
